Common Ecommerce Security Threats

There are various types of security threats that ecommerce businesses commonly face. Familiarizing yourself with these threats will allow you to implement targeted security measures.

1. Phishing Attacks

Phishing attacks involve cybercriminals posing as legitimate entities to trick users into revealing sensitive information. They often send deceptive emails or create fake websites that mimic trusted brands. Train your employees and customers on how to identify phishing attempts and report them immediately.

2. SQL Injection

SQL injection occurs when attackers exploit vulnerabilities in your website’s code to gain unauthorized access to your database. They can manipulate or extract sensitive data, compromising your customers’ information. Regularly conduct security audits and code reviews to identify and fix SQL injection vulnerabilities.

3. Distributed Denial of Service (DDoS) Attacks

DDoS attacks overload your website’s servers with a flood of traffic, making your website inaccessible to legitimate users. Implementing strong network security measures, such as firewalls and traffic filtering, can help mitigate the impact of DDoS attacks.

4. Cross-Site Scripting (XSS)

XSS attacks involve injecting malicious scripts into your website, which are then executed on the user’s browser. This allows attackers to steal sensitive information or gain unauthorized access to user accounts. Regularly update and patch your website’s software and plugins to prevent XSS vulnerabilities.

5. Insider Threats

Insider threats occur when employees or contractors abuse their access privileges to steal or misuse sensitive data. Implement strict access controls, employee training, and monitor user activities to detect and prevent insider threats.

6. Magecart Attacks

Magecart attacks involve compromising third-party scripts or plugins integrated into your website to steal payment information. Regularly review and update the security of your integrated third-party services to minimize the risk of Magecart attacks.

7. Man-in-the-Middle Attacks

In a man-in-the-middle attack, cybercriminals intercept communication between users and your website to eavesdrop or alter the data exchanged. Implementing SSL/TLS encryption and regularly checking for certificate validity can protect against this type of attack.

8. Brute Force Attacks

Brute force attacks involve cybercriminals attempting to gain access to user accounts by systematically trying various password combinations. Enforce strong password policies, implement account lockouts after failed login attempts, and consider implementing multi-factor authentication to protect against brute force attacks.

Implementing Secure Payment Gateways

One of the first steps towards ecommerce security is ensuring secure payment processing. Integrating reliable and trusted payment gateways, such as PayPal or Stripe, can significantly reduce the risk of payment fraud. These gateways utilize advanced encryption techniques to protect customer payment information during transactions, providing peace of mind to both you and your customers.

Choosing a Secure Payment Gateway

When selecting a payment gateway, it is crucial to choose one that complies with the Payment Card Industry Data Security Standard (PCI DSS). This standard ensures that the gateway meets stringent security requirements, minimizing the chances of data breaches.

Consider the following factors when choosing a secure payment gateway:

1. PCI DSS Compliance

Ensure that the payment gateway is PCI DSS compliant. This certification guarantees that the gateway follows industry best practices for securely processing and storing sensitive financial information.

2. Tokenization

Tokenization is a security technique that replaces sensitive payment data with unique tokens. This ensures that even if the tokenized data is intercepted, it is useless to attackers. Look for payment gateways that offer tokenization to enhance security.

3. Fraud Detection and Prevention

Choose a payment gateway that offers robust fraud detection and prevention mechanisms. Features such as address verification, card verification value (CVV) checks, and real-time transaction monitoring can help detect and prevent fraudulent activities.

4. Strong Encryption

Encryption is essential for securing data during transmission. Look for payment gateways that use strong encryption protocols, such as Transport Layer Security (TLS) or Secure Sockets Layer (SSL), to protect customer payment information.

Securing the Payment Process

In addition to choosing a secure payment gateway, there are several steps you can take to enhance the security of the payment process on your ecommerce website.

1. Hosted Payment Pages

Consider using hosted payment pages provided by the payment gateway. This means that the payment process occurs on the gateway’s secure servers, reducing your website’s exposure to potential security risks.

2. Payment Card Industry (PCI) Compliance

Ensure that your ecommerce website is PCI compliant. This involves adhering to a set of security standards defined by the PCI Security Standards Council. Compliance with these standards helps protect customer payment data and reduces the risk of data breaches.

3. Secure Socket Layer (SSL) Encryption

Implement SSL encryption throughout your ecommerce website to protect customer data during transmission. This involves installing an SSL certificate and configuring your server to use HTTPS for all webpages.

4. Two-Factor Authentication (2FA)

Consider implementing two-factor authentication for customer accounts. This provides an additional layer of security by requiring users to provide a second verification factor, such as a unique code sent to their mobile device, in addition to their password.

5. Regular Security Audits

Conduct regular security audits of your payment process to identify and address any vulnerabilities. Engage the services of a reputable security firm to perform comprehensive audits and penetration testing to uncover potential weaknesses.

6. Data Minimization

6. Data Minimization (continued)

Minimize the amount of customer payment data you store. Only retain necessary information for transaction processing and promptly delete any unnecessary data. The less data you store, the lower the risk of a data breach.

7. Regular Updates and Patching

Keep your ecommerce platform and payment gateway up to date with the latest security patches and updates. This ensures that any known vulnerabilities are patched, reducing the risk of exploitation by cybercriminals.

8. Employee Training

Educate your employees about the importance of secure payment processing and train them on best practices. Emphasize the need to handle customer payment data with care and caution, and provide clear guidelines on how to identify and report any suspicious activities or potential security breaches.

Obtaining an SSL Certificate

Securing your ecommerce website with an SSL (Secure Sockets Layer) certificate is crucial for protecting customer data. An SSL certificate encrypts the data transmitted between your website and the user’s browser, making it extremely difficult for hackers to intercept and decipher the information.

The Benefits of SSL Certificates

Implementing an SSL certificate offers several benefits for your ecommerce website:

1. Data Encryption

An SSL certificate encrypts sensitive data, such as customer payment information, during transmission. This ensures that even if intercepted, the data is unreadable to attackers.

2. Trust and Customer Confidence

Displaying the padlock icon and “https://” in the browser’s address bar signals to customers that your website is secure. This builds trust and confidence in your brand, increasing the likelihood of customers completing transactions on your site.

3. SEO Benefits

Google considers SSL encryption as a ranking factor, meaning having an SSL certificate can positively impact your website’s search engine rankings. This can potentially lead to increased visibility and organic traffic.

4. Protection Against Phishing Attacks

SSL certificates help protect against phishing attacks by displaying trust indicators to users. This makes it more difficult for attackers to create fake websites that mimic your brand and deceive customers.

Types of SSL Certificates

There are different types of SSL certificates available, depending on your specific needs:

1. Domain Validated (DV) Certificates

Domain Validated certificates are the simplest and quickest to obtain. They only validate the domain ownership but do not provide information about the organization or business behind the website. DV certificates are suitable for smaller ecommerce websites or blogs.

2. Organization Validated (OV) Certificates

Organization Validated certificates provide a higher level of validation by verifying the organization’s identity in addition to domain ownership. OV certificates display the organization’s name in the certificate details, increasing customer trust and confidence.

3. Extended Validation (EV) Certificates

Extended Validation certificates provide the highest level of validation and display the organization’s name prominently in the browser’s address bar. EV certificates undergo a thorough validation process, including verifying legal and operational details of the organization. This type of certificate is recommended for larger ecommerce websites and businesses that handle significant customer transactions.

Installation and Configuration

Obtaining an SSL certificate involves several steps:

1. Choose a Certificate Authority (CA)

Select a reputable Certificate Authority that offers SSL certificates. Popular CAs include Let’s Encrypt, DigiCert, and Comodo. Consider factors such as price, customer support, and compatibility with your hosting provider.

2. Generate a Certificate Signing Request (CSR)

Generate a CSR from your web hosting control panel or server. This request contains information about your website and organization, which the CA uses to issue the SSL certificate.

3. Submit CSR and Complete Validation

Submit the CSR to the chosen CA and complete their validation process. The CA may require you to provide supporting documents to verify your organization’s identity. Once the validation is complete, the CA will issue the SSL certificate.

4. Install and Configure the SSL Certificate

Install the SSL certificate on your web server or hosting control panel. Follow the instructions provided by your hosting provider or refer to documentation provided by the CA for specific installation steps.

5. Update Internal Links and Resources

After installing the SSL certificate, update all internal links and resources on your website to use the “https://” protocol. This ensures that all elements on your website, including images, scripts, and stylesheets, are loaded securely.

6. Test and Verify SSL Configuration

Perform thorough testing to ensure that the SSL certificate is configured correctly and all pages are loading securely. Use online SSL checker tools to verify the SSL configuration and resolve any issues that may arise.

Types of Security Audits

There are various types of security audits that you can perform:

1. Vulnerability Assessment

A vulnerability assessment involves scanning and testing your ecommerce platform for known vulnerabilities. Automated tools are used to identify weaknesses that can be exploited by attackers. This type of audit helps identify common vulnerabilities such as outdated software, weak passwords, or misconfigured server settings.

2. Penetration Testing

Penetration testing, also known as ethical hacking, involves simulating real-world attacks on your ecommerce platform. Skilled professionals attempt to exploit vulnerabilities and gain unauthorized access to your system. Penetration testing provides a comprehensive assessment of your platform’s security and helps uncover potential weaknesses that may not be identified through automated scans.

3. Code Review

A code review involves a detailed examination of your website’s source code to identify any security flaws or vulnerabilities. It helps uncover issues such as SQL injection, cross-site scripting, or insecure coding practices. Performing regular code reviews is essential, especially after making significant updates or adding new functionality to your website.

4. Configuration Audit

A configuration audit involves reviewing the settings and configurations of your website’s server, database, and other infrastructure components. This audit ensures that these components are properly configured and secure against potential attacks.

Securing Customer Data

The security of your customers’ data should be a top priority. Implementing measures to protect this data is crucial in maintaining their trust and complying with privacy regulations. Store customer data securely by using encryption techniques to mask sensitive information such as credit card numbers or social security numbers.

Data Encryption

Implement encryption protocols to protect customer data both during transmission and storage. Encryption scrambles the data, making it unreadable to unauthorized individuals. Consider the following encryption methods:

1. Transport Layer Security (TLS)

Implement TLS encryption to secure data transmitted between your ecommerce platform and customers’ browsers. TLS ensures that data is encrypted during transit, making it extremely difficult for attackers to intercept and decipher.

2. Database Encryption

Utilize database encryption to protect customer data stored in your databases. Encryption ensures that even if the database is compromised, the data remains secure.

3. Tokenization

Consider tokenization as an additional security measure for sensitive customer data. Tokenization replaces the actual data with unique tokens, which are then used for processing and storage. This reduces the risk of unauthorized access to sensitive customer information.

Data Retention Policies

Implementing a data retention policy is essential in minimizing the amount of customer data stored and reducing the risk of data breaches. Determine the necessary period for which customer data needs to be retained, and regularly purge any outdated or unnecessary customer records from your database.

Secure Data Transmission

Take precautions to secure the transmission of customer data within your ecommerce platform:

1. Secure Sockets Layer (SSL)

Ensure that your website uses SSL encryption for all pages that handle customer data. This includes checkout pages, registration forms, and any other pages where sensitive information is collected.

2. Secure File Transfer Protocol (SFTP)

Use SFTP for securely transferring files containing customer data between your ecommerce platform and other systems or third-party services. SFTP encrypts data during transit, providing an additional layer of security.

3. Secure APIs and Web Services

If your ecommerce platform integrates with external APIs or web services, ensure that these connections are secured using encryption and authentication mechanisms. This protects the integrity and confidentiality of customer data exchanged between systems.

Monitoring and Detection Systems

Investing in monitoring and detection systems can help identify and mitigate security threats promptly. Intrusion Detection Systems (IDS) and Intrusion Prevention Systems (IPS) monitor your website’s network traffic for suspicious activities or patterns that may indicate a cyber attack.

Intrusion Detection Systems (IDS)

An IDS monitors network traffic and system logs, looking for signs of suspicious or malicious activity. It alerts administrators or security personnel when potential threats are detected, allowing them to take appropriate actions to mitigate the risks.

Intrusion Prevention Systems (IPS)

An IPS goes a step further than an IDS by actively blocking or preventing unauthorized access or malicious activity. It can automatically take actions to stop or prevent attacks, such as blocking IP addresses or denying access to certain resources.

Related Article:  Ecommerce Chatbots for 24/7 Customer Engagement

Web Application Firewall (WAF)

A Web Application Firewall (WAF) acts as a barrier between your ecommerce platform and potential attackers. It filters out malicious traffic, blocks known attack vectors, and protects against common web application vulnerabilities such as SQL injection and cross-site scripting (XSS) attacks.

Log Monitoring and Analysis

Regularly monitor and analyze logs generated by your ecommerce platform, network devices, and security systems. Log analysis can help identify patterns, anomalies, or indicators of compromise that may signify a security breach or attempted attack.

Real-Time Alerts and Incident Response

Configure real-time alerts for security events and incidents. When an alert is triggered, respond promptly by investigating and taking appropriate action to mitigate the threat. Develop an incident response plan that outlines the steps to be followed in the event of a security incident.

Components of a Backup and Disaster Recovery Plan

A backup and disaster recovery plan typically includes the following components:

1. Regular Data Backups

Establish a schedule for regular data backups, including website files, databases, and customer data. Determine the frequency of backups based on the volume of data changes and the criticality of the information.

2. Offsite Storage

Store backup copies of your data in an offsite location, separate from your primary server or data center. This protects your data in the event of physical damage or theft at your primary location.

3. Incremental and Full Backups

Use a combination of incremental and full backups to optimize storage space and reduce backup time. Incremental backups capture only the changes made since the last backup, while full backups capture the entire dataset. This approach allows for quicker recovery while minimizing resource usage.

4. Testing and Validation

Regularly test and validate your backup and recovery processes to ensure that your data can be successfully restored. Perform test recoveries in a controlled environment to verify the integrity and availability of your backup data.

5. Documented Procedures

Create clear and detailed documentation of your backup and disaster recovery procedures. Include step-by-step instructions for data restoration, contact information for key personnel, and any specific considerations or dependencies.

6. Incident Response Plan

Develop an incident response plan that outlines the steps to be taken in the event of a security breach or system failure. This plan should include roles and responsibilities, communication protocols, and escalation procedures.

7. Redundancy and Failover Systems

Consider implementing redundancy and failover systems to minimize downtime in the event of a system failure. Redundancy involves having duplicate hardware or servers in place, while failover systems automatically switch to backup systems when the primary system fails.

8. Data Retention Policies

Define data retention policies that specify how long backup data should be kept. This helps ensure compliance with legal and regulatory requirements and minimizes storage costs.
